What Is Ice Damming?
Ice damming refers to the buildup of ice along the edge of a roof, typically above the eaves, that prevents melted snow from draining off properly. This phenomenon is common in areas like Ithaca, NY, where winter temperatures fluctuate above and below freezing.
When snow accumulates on a roof and heat escapes from the living space below, it can cause the underside of the snow layer to melt. The resulting water flows down toward the colder eaves and gutters, refreezing into a band of ice. Over time, this ice barrier traps additional meltwater, which can then seep under shingles and leak into the home, leading to water damage and mold growth.
Why Do Ice Dams Happen So Often in Ithaca, NY?
Ice dams are particularly common in Ithaca because of the region’s cold winters mixed with spells of milder weather. Frequent freeze-thaw cycles and heavy, wet snowfall set up the right conditions for the process.
Local homes often have features that contribute to the risk:
- Older, poorly insulated attics that allow heat to escape into the roof space
- Roofs with shallow pitches or valleys, where snow accumulates and doesn’t quickly slide off
- Large overhangs, which stay colder than the main roof
In this climate, even well-maintained houses can experience ice dams if attic insulation and ventilation aren’t optimized.
What Problems Can Ice Dams Cause for Homeowners?
Left unchecked, ice dams can:
- Allow water to infiltrate attics, ceilings, walls, and insulation
- Lead to mold growth and damaged plaster or drywall
- Weaken structural wood by repeated wetting
- Cause paint to peel and wood trim around windows or eaves to rot
- Pull gutters loose due to the weight of the ice
A common misconception is that only old or poorly built homes experience water damage from ice dams. In reality, even relatively new roofs can be affected if insulation or ventilation is inadequate for local conditions.
How Can Local Residents Prevent Ice Dams from Forming?
The most effective way to prevent ice dams is to keep the entire roof as close to the same (cold) temperature as the outside air. This limits the snowmelt-and-refreeze cycle that leads to trouble. Steps that offer long-term benefits include:
Improve Attic Insulation
A well-insulated attic blocks heat from rising and warming the roof surface.
- Add or upgrade attic floor insulation, aiming for R-values suited for cold climates (R-38 or higher is typical).
- Seal air leaks where warm air escapes from the living space to the roof cavity—pay attention to gaps around plumbing vents, electrical outlets, recessed lights, and attic hatches.
Enhance Roof Ventilation
Proper ventilation helps carry away any heat that does escape.
- Soffit vents let cold outside air enter at the eaves.
- Ridge or gable vents allow warm, moist air to exit near the roof peak.
A continuous flow of air keeps the roof deck cooler, making it harder for ice dams to form.
Manage Snow Accumulation
After heavy snowfall, some residents use a roof rake to safely remove snow from the lower few feet of roof while standing on the ground. This reduces the amount of melting snow available to form an ice dam.
- Avoid accessing the roof on your own if it is icy, steep, or unusually high.
- Never use sharp tools or de-icing chemicals that can damage roof shingles.

Address Chronic Problem Areas
Homes with persistent issues may have architectural features that encourage ice buildup. In such cases, it may be useful to:
- Redirect heat sources in the attic away from the roof deck
- Insulate or reroute exhaust ductwork so it doesn’t release warm air directly under the roof
- Consider installing self-regulating heat cables along the roof edge in severe cases (heat cables provide a last resort for especially tricky spots, not a replacement for insulation and ventilation)
Are There Seasonal Home Maintenance Habits That Help?
Regular chores can also help residents stay ahead of potential ice dam problems:
- Clean gutters and downspouts in late fall to make sure melting snow and ice can drain freely
- Inspect the edges of the roof for damage once snow melts in early spring
- Check attic insulation for signs of water staining or mold and repair air leaks as soon as practical
What Should Local Residents Avoid Doing?
Some fixes are ineffective or even risky. Avoid:
- Chipping away at ice dams from the roof with an axe or shovel, as this can damage shingles and is unsafe
- Using salt or chemical-based melting agents on shingles, which can corrode metal flashing and stain exterior walls
- Ignoring small leaks—moisture in the attic can promote mold, which is harder to remove after it spreads
How Does Local Housing Influence Ice Dam Risk?
Ithaca’s mix of historic and modern homes means that solutions can vary widely. Older homes may lack modern air-sealing techniques but often have easily accessible attics for insulation upgrades. In contrast, newer homes sometimes use complex roof designs that create hidden valleys or overhangs where snow lingers. Awareness of each home's unique construction can guide which prevention methods are most effective.
